Output 370c509053dde998c1d5d246fa5828569c0033368a445541326694afeb4021c6:8

value
26271252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6a75208449a13353adc6dc719d0f75d4c779e27 OP_EQUAL
address
MP6LquGLNdR93WJr1Pig3rh88KcrtXwpzV
transaction
370c509053dde998c1d5d246fa5828569c0033368a445541326694afeb4021c6
spent
true